Pierre Poilievre will be on Joe Rogan podcast expected later Thursday
Conservative Leader Pierre Poilievre is set to appear on the popular Joe Rogan podcast, discussing Canadian trade interests and tariffs imposed by the U.S.
Pierre Poilievre, the leader of the Conservative Party in Canada, is gearing up for an appearance on "The Joe Rogan Experience" podcast, which is renowned for its vast audience and influence. With the episode scheduled to be released later Thursday, Poilievre expressed optimism about the platform's reach, underscoring the significance of discussing Canadian issues on a global stage. He highlighted the podcast's popularity, noting how the top episodes have garnered hundreds of millions of views, thereby reflecting the potential impact of his appearance.
In his announcement on social media, Poilievre emphasized that he fought for 'Canadian workers and Canadian interests' during his conversation with Rogan. While the specifics of the podcast episode remain under wraps until its release, he indicated that the discussion would touch on tariff issues related to U.S. President Donald Trump's policies. Poilievre advocates for a tariff-free trade environment, which he sees as essential for the future economic health of Canada.
